It’s a roar that “makes the entire town shake.”
It’s the Lakefest Drag Boat Races, a three-day boat racing event in Lakeside Park and Johnson Park sponsored by the Marble Falls/ Highland Lakes Area Chamber of Commerce on May 20-22.
“You can be three miles away and still hear the boats,” said Katie Savage, Special Events Coordinator, Marble Falls Chamber of Commerce.

The most important tips for any new collector:
1. Figure out what you like. The better education you have, the better collection you’ll have.
I suggest going to museums and art galleries and trying to familiarize yourself with different periods and styles.
Very often you evolve from what you originally thought you liked so don’t be surprised when you look back.
